Dogs Fill the Gaps We Didn’t Know Existed
Dogs have a sixth sense for what we need. They curl up next to us when we’re sad, bring out our playful side when we’ve forgotten how to laugh, and greet us like returning heroes even if we just stepped outside to grab the mail. They don’t care what we look like, how messy the house is, or what kind of day we’ve had—they love us with the kind of loyalty that makes your heart ache a little.
In return, we give them everything we’ve got: cozy beds (even if it’s actually our bed), morning walks in pajamas, and birthday parties with bone-shaped cakes. Why? Because they deserve it. Because they make our lives whole.
A Dog's Joy Is the Family's Joy
There’s something wonderfully contagious about a dog’s joy. Whether it’s the zoomies in the backyard, a triumphant catch of the tennis ball, or the head-tilt of curiosity at a squeaky toy, their happiness becomes ours. Families laugh more, walk more, and play more when there’s a dog around. Heck, some of us even talk in full dog voices and refer to ourselves as "Mom" and "Dad." (Don’t worry, we do it too.)
Dogs Teach Us the Good Stuff
Patience. Forgiveness. Living in the moment. Dogs are furry little zen masters with paws. They teach kids responsibility, adults how to slow down, and all of us how to love unconditionally. They’re not just family members—they’re teachers, comedians, therapists, and alarm clocks, all rolled into one perfect, wagging package.
